The best way to check is to take a reading before and after a period of time of not using any water to see how far the meter has gone on.

 

With most disputes arising over the accuracy of meter readings the company concerned make a charge to send the meter off to be calibrated, the same system of complaints, is I think, used by all the utilities.

http://www.nwml.gov.uk/Docs/Meter%20Accuracy%20and%20Billing%20Disputes.pdf[/url]

 

otherwise it may be worth while to contact The Consumer Council for Water
